開始制作

開發(fā)電商系統(tǒng)APP,選擇原生還是混合開發(fā)?

2024-11-07 13:05:00 來自于應(yīng)用公園

在開發(fā)電商系統(tǒng)APP時,企業(yè)面臨著一個重要的選擇:是采用原生開發(fā)還是混合開發(fā)?本文將從性能、用戶體驗、開發(fā)成本、跨平臺兼容性等多個維度,對這兩種開發(fā)方式進行深入探討,以幫助企業(yè)做出更明智的決策。
開發(fā)電商系統(tǒng)APP,選擇原生還是混合開發(fā)?

一、原生開發(fā)的優(yōu)勢

?1. 卓越的性能與用戶體驗?
原生開發(fā)直接利用手機操作系統(tǒng)提供的開發(fā)語言和工具,如iOS的Swift和Android的Kotlin,能夠充分發(fā)揮手機硬件的性能優(yōu)勢。這意味著原生APP在響應(yīng)速度、流暢度、動畫效果等方面表現(xiàn)更為出色,能夠為用戶帶來更加流暢、自然的操作體驗。對于電商APP而言,良好的用戶體驗直接關(guān)系到用戶的購物滿意度和忠誠度。

?2. 深度定制與功能完善?
原生開發(fā)允許開發(fā)團隊根據(jù)具體需求進行深度定制,實現(xiàn)復(fù)雜的功能和效果。在電商系統(tǒng)中,這意味著可以集成更多的個性化推薦算法、支付接口、物流跟蹤等功能,提升用戶購物的便捷性和滿意度。同時,原生APP可以直接訪問手機的各種硬件資源,如攝像頭、GPS等,為用戶提供更加豐富的交互體驗。

二、混合開發(fā)的考量

?1. 跨平臺兼容性與開發(fā)效率?
混合開發(fā)采用跨平臺開發(fā)框架,如React Native、Flutter等,可以實現(xiàn)一套代碼同時運行在iOS和Android等多個平臺上。這種開發(fā)方式顯著提高了開發(fā)效率,降低了跨平臺開發(fā)的成本。對于電商系統(tǒng)APP而言,能夠快速響應(yīng)市場變化,推出適用于不同操作系統(tǒng)的版本,對于搶占市場份額具有重要意義。
?
2. 成本節(jié)約與維護便捷?
相對于原生開發(fā),混合開發(fā)在開發(fā)成本和維護成本上具有一定優(yōu)勢。由于使用統(tǒng)一的開發(fā)語言和框架,開發(fā)團隊可以減少對不同平臺的學(xué)習(xí)成本和時間投入。同時,在版本更新和維護時,混合開發(fā)也更為便捷,只需在服務(wù)器端進行升級即可,無需重新提交應(yīng)用商店審核。

三、選擇原生還是混合?
?
1. 根據(jù)業(yè)務(wù)需求與用戶體驗決定?
在選擇原生開發(fā)還是混合開發(fā)時,企業(yè)應(yīng)首先考慮自身的業(yè)務(wù)需求和用戶體驗要求。如果企業(yè)對性能和用戶體驗有較高要求,且愿意投入更多的開發(fā)成本和時間,那么原生開發(fā)無疑是更好的選擇。然而,如果企業(yè)更注重開發(fā)效率和成本節(jié)約,且業(yè)務(wù)需求相對簡單,那么混合開發(fā)可能是一個更合適的選擇。
?
2. 綜合考慮跨平臺兼容性與開發(fā)周期?
跨平臺兼容性是混合開發(fā)的一大優(yōu)勢,但也可能帶來兼容性問題。不同平臺的操作系統(tǒng)版本、屏幕尺寸和分辨率等存在差異,混合開發(fā)需要在這些方面進行適配和優(yōu)化。因此,在選擇混合開發(fā)時,企業(yè)應(yīng)綜合考慮自身的跨平臺需求以及開發(fā)團隊的適配能力。同時,開發(fā)周期也是需要考慮的因素之一。原生開發(fā)通常需要較長的開發(fā)周期,而混合開發(fā)則可能更快地推出產(chǎn)品。

?3. 靈活應(yīng)對市場變化?
在快速變化的電商市場中,企業(yè)需要根據(jù)市場反饋和用戶需求不斷調(diào)整和優(yōu)化產(chǎn)品。因此,在選擇開發(fā)方式時,企業(yè)還應(yīng)考慮自身的靈活性和響應(yīng)速度。原生開發(fā)雖然性能優(yōu)越,但更新和維護成本較高;混合開發(fā)雖然可能在某些方面性能稍遜,但其快速迭代和跨平臺兼容性的優(yōu)勢也不容忽視。

綜上所述,開發(fā)電商系統(tǒng)APP時選擇原生開發(fā)還是混合開發(fā),需要根據(jù)企業(yè)的實際需求和資源狀況進行綜合考量。無論選擇哪種方式,都應(yīng)注重用戶體驗和產(chǎn)品質(zhì)量,以不斷提升用戶滿意度和市場競爭力。
粵公網(wǎng)安備 44030602002171號      粵ICP備15056436號-2

在線咨詢

立即咨詢

售前咨詢熱線

0755-27805158

[關(guān)閉]
應(yīng)用公園微信

官方微信自助客服

[關(guān)閉]